The Goethe Talents Scholarship is a 12-day programme to support and connect young, aspiring musical artists including singer-songwriters and composers.

The scholarship is a cooperation between the Goethe-Institut and »Pop-Kultur« and will celebrate its 10 years cooperation anniversary in 2024.




The programme offers a variety of activities to experience the “music city” Berlin before the actual Festival: Studio visits, intensive group jam-sessions, short traineeships in selected companies from Berlin’s creative industries, listening sessions and meetings with scholarship holders of the Musicboard Berlin GmbH, as well as other activities. Highlights of the promotion and exchange programme are the participation in »Pop-Kultur Nachwuchs«, the official talent programme of the festival, intensive Studio collaborations of all Goethe Talents 2024 participants and of course experiencing the full programme of »Pop-Kultur« Live.

The scholarship is directed at musicians between ~20 and ~30 years of age who have already gained some experience in the field of music and have a solid grasp of the English language.

The programme is particularly focused on musical talents from the so called DAC-Countries.

The talents are selected after an international application process through the worldwide network of the Goethe-Institut running from February 28th, 2024 until April 2nd, 12 pm CEST 2024.
